    Computers are only as fast as the slowest thing in them. Always remember this. So if you get 2gb of memory but a crappy HD, processor, vid card, it’s not going to help your cause.
    And if you want to do all that stuff at the same time, make SURE to get a dual core (Pentium D or, my favorite, AMD 64×2) processor! A fast hard drive would be beneficial to you as well since you’re talking downloading/saving all the time.

    2 GB of RAM is good although I do much of what you’re doing off 1 GB of RAM (at the same time). 2 GB will just make things work smoother and more speedier on your PC.
    However, as technology progresses, so does the amount of resources needed to accomplish tasks. Therefore if you want to make the most out of your 2 GB, make sure you have a throaty processor and your motherboard allows the expansion for more RAM (say up to 4 GB?). Then you’ll have something that really moves.
